Shaanxi is the political center of the history of the mainland, there are many emperors here to establish an empire, and then due to the change of dynasties many cultural relics are buried in Shaanxi, so far a large number of cultural relics have been excavated by the museum collection, today to say that the Tiliang silver jar. In the 1970s, more than 1,000 ancient cultural relics left over from the Tang Dynasty, two large urns and a small silver jar of Tiliang, were discovered in Hejia Village, Xi'an, due to local workers' construction.

These treasures are Liu Zhen, who was responsible for managing the treasures in the palace during the Tang Dynasty, because of the Jingyuan soldiers, he buried most of the treasures in the palace in the ground, and then he was killed by the emperor after surrendering to the enemy army for fear of death, and then the treasures were no longer known, until the experts found that they could see the light of day, and these treasures caused everyone to be surprised after they were unearthed, including a large number of Coins, Aromatherapy, Rhino Horn Cups and other Tang Dynasty treasures, and even several of the antiquities have become the country's special national treasures, collected in museums.

The most eye-catching thing is the small silver jar next to it, which is different from the other two urns and is placed separately. After carefully opening the lid on it, the expert saw a scene of great shock, and the expert could not explain the principle. According to experts, there is half a jar of clear water in the jar but a sheet of gold leaf floating on the surface of the water, and the most strange thing is why this gold leaf floats on the surface of the water. The gold leaf is made of gold, and there are twelve dragons on the gold leaf, each dragon is about four centimeters long and about two centimeters high, and the weight of each dragon is about thirty grams, and there is also a weight of half a kilogram floating on the water, which can't help but make experts wonder.

In later studies, experts found that these dragon walkers were all Daoist monks in the Tang Dynasty who prayed for the blessing of the gods, and the dragon throwing ceremony was a required prop, and suspected that perhaps the Taoist priests cast spells, and we guessed that the liquid in the jar was not water, but a clear liquid like mercury, or like a magic trick now, it was just a kind of blindfold method used by the Taoists at that time.
